The BBC radio comedy Radio Active featured Michael Fenton Stevens playing an incompetent hospital radio-trained presenter. He was carried over to the TV spin-off KYTV . Fictional character Alan Partridge is said to have begun his radio career on Radio Smile at St Luke's Hospital, but left following arguments with patients.

Radio Lollipop is a charitable organization providing a care, comfort, play and entertainment service for children in hospital.It organizes Volunteer Playmakers to spend time with children in wards or in special play areas, taking its name from the radio stations it runs in hospitals playing children's programming - part-presented by children themselves.

Radio Chelsea and Westminster [15] is the hospital's own hospital radio station, available for; patients, staff and the local community. The hospital plays host to Coventry Hospital Radio, a free station provided through the Hospedia bedside units and now online via their website. The station is situated on the 5th floor and is available to all wards and online via the website providing music, entertainment and chat 24 hours a day, 7 days a week. [21] [22]
Student-run — Stations where students play significant roles in programming, management, and other facets of operations, either on their own, through student government organizations, or under faculty supervision. Many student-run stations also allow community volunteers to participate as program hosts. [1] [2]
